Indeed this is a general problem for anyone wanting > to enable all kernel modules. I don't know how ALL_KMODS works > in OpenWRT, but there are other related problems that make this > a hard problem, which means you need a whitelist or blacklist > of some sort anyway: > > - Some modules are only visible depending on some other 'bool' > symbol, so you have to know which of those symbols to turn > on first > > - Some 'tristate' symbols not only control whether a module > is built but also impact the rest of the kernel. > > - Some modules are related to 'choice' statement or other > options that have mutually incompatible settings.
Luckily we already have solutions or workarounds in place for most of these, like encoding a hash of the kernel configuration in the version of the kernel (module) packages, and requiring an exact match on installation. Coming back to the original issue, I think there are only two viable (short-term) solutions for mvebu (and any other target affected): a) Set PTP_1588_CLOCK=y for mvebu, forcing it always on. b) Disallow PTP_1588_CLOCK for mvebu, preventing it from being enabled. so essentially treating it like a bool. Since most mvebu devices are on the beefier side with plenty of RAM and flash, I think a) is fine and shouldn't hurt too much. In theory it would also be possible to make the switch driver a module and let preinit load it (and include the ptp module optionally), but this would be effectively the same as a) for releases/ALL_KMOD builds, just more complicated, and less space efficient.
